#d43569 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d43569 is composed of 83.1% red, 20.8%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75% magenta, 50.5%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 340.4 degrees, a saturation of 64.9% and a lightness of 52%. #d43569 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6ad2 with #a90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

● #d43569 color description : Strong pink.
#d43569 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d43569 has RGB values of R:212, G:53,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.5,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13907305.

Shades and Tints of #d43569
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080204 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d43569
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898083 is the less saturated color, while #fa0f5c is the most saturated one.
